it depends on what it is that you're IVing.. if it's something with a rush it would be easy to know if you got it in a vein because you would feel a rush, if you missed it would be a slower onset and the rush (if you even get one) would be more subtle.
but if it's something without a rush.. you pretty much have to go by how long it takes to get the effect from the drug. so if one shot you get high in 1-3minutes and later in the day your next shot gets you high in 10-20minutes you probably missed some or most of it.

I am not trying to derail and harm prevention facts, but i own a microscope and the pictures of the used needles are without a doubt exaggerated. Taking into account the set they used may have been of severely sub-par quality. I examined a standard BD insulin syringe under my microscope and after 10 uses it was still substantially less "hooked" or damaged then the picture shown for 6 uses. I feel like it would have taken another 5 to 10 uses to be that damaged, but i would rather not use one on myself that many times considering i am not a chronic IV drug user and don't "need" to use a kit that many times. My worst case scenario from what you describe is blood poisoning - the line down your vein towards your heart, that is getting longer, is a classic symptom.

If this is the case - it's extrememly serious and needs medical attention.

Of course it might just be a bruise and you don't need to stress - but be alert for other symptoms of infection - fever, chills, pain etc

Once the needle is in the skin, pull back on the plungera bit to create a tiny air pocket, once the vein is peirced a bit of blood will shoot into the rig. At this point you are in the vein. Now if a lot of bright red blood pushes the plunger back you have hit an artery DO NOT shoot, you will usually know because it burns and you won't get the rush, just pain and swelling. Once you are in the vein as described above you can take the plunge (so to speak) there is a huge very informative thread about this UTSE. Have fun and be safe.
 
yes, the forearm veins are fine to inject into - you would definitely know whether you hit a nerve (intense sharp pain) or artery (sharp pain, burning sensation when injected and swelling) from the intense pains associated.

is there any swelling or redness at the injection site? could you elaborate a bit more?

if there is i would apply a hot compress for 20mins to help the missed shot absorb and reduce the swelling, redness and possible bruising. have a read through here on how to treat missed shots.
